Corporate Counsel The candidate will provide day-to-day legal counsel to clients on general corporate and compliance matters. Provide ongoing legal guidance and support throughout the contract lifecycle, including drafting, negotiating, and revising contracts. Provide ongoing legal guidance and support for land matters, including easements, permitting, rights-of-way, condemnations, commercial leasing, and land acquisitions. Support development and implementation of contract management strategy. Collaborate with internal clients to proactively mitigate risk. Provide legal support for the company insurance program, including advising on policy interpretations and risk transfer guidance. Review, draft, and provide general legal counsel on corporate policies. Collaborate with legal team and clients to identify and implement process improvements. Build cross-functional relationships with team members. Obtain and maintain a solid knowledge of the company’s business. Other assigned duties.
Qualification and Experience
The candidate should have a JD from an accredited law school. Licensed to practice law and in good standing in at least one State Bar. Should have 3-8 years of experience in a law firm or corporate setting. Solid contract drafting and real estate experience are required. Experience with contract compliance, renewable energy, business continuity/disaster recovery, or utility regulation is preferred. Exercise sound judgment with a business-friendly approach to legal problem solving and be able to effectively counsel clients with concise, practical advice and creative solutions. Ability to influence value-added outcomes with clients utilizing legal expertise. Strong interpersonal and communication skills, including an ability to interface effectively with all levels and keep stakeholders regularly and timely updated. Possess a strong desire to learn the business and new areas of law. Able to quickly gain a rapport with business personnel to encourage proactive use of in-house legal counsel. Able to work effectively and cooperatively with cross-functional colleagues in a geographically dispersed organization. A proven ability to manage multiple projects with an excellent ability to set priorities and manage expectations on deliverables and deadlines. Self-starter who is sharp, quick to pick up new concepts, and willing to dig in and become an “expert” as needs arise. Must be able to travel as necessary and utilize other strategies to ensure effective collaboration and productivity.
